

Larry was born to Fenton and Maxine Macke February 13, 1945 in Paris, IL. He graduated from Marshall High School in 1963 and went to serve in the United States Marine Corps and is a Vietnam War Veteran becoming a member of Post 104 in Terre Haute. Following his military service he worked for and retired from the United States Postal Service. Larry married the love of his life Suzanne in 1968 and together they raised a son and a daughter.
Larry was a passionate sports fan, especially the San Francisco Giants and Willie Mays. He loved to coach his son’s teams and watch his grandson play as well. He played on numerous baseball and softball teams well into his forties and was an avid collector of sports memorabilia. He also enjoyed his weekly Wednesday morning breakfasts with his post office friends.
Larry is survived by his loving wife of 56 years, Suzanne Macke; daughter Kim Thompson (Glenn); son Bryan Macke (Erik); sister Shirley Icenogle (Stan); brother Fenton Macke (Judi); granddaughter Samantha Bernstein (Adam); grandson Dylan Bernstein; several aunts, uncles, cousins, nieces and nephews; and many wonderful friends.
He is preceded in death by his parents Fenton and Maxine Macke, step-mom Jane Macke, father-in-law James Daugherty, and mother-in-law Eulalia Daugherty.
He loved his family very much, was a wonderful husband, father, and grandfather. He will be dearly missed.
